Wax figures of the royal family at Madame Tussauds in London have been dressed in ugly Christmas sweaters — with Kate and her hubby, Prince William, wearing a particularly ~interesting~ garment.

The Duke and Duchess of Cambridge, whose wax figures are normally seen dressed up with Kate in a navy blue knee-length dress and William in a smart suit, were unveiled today in a slightly unnerving, but somehow still very sweet, Christmas sweater built for two.

But hold the phone! Our favorite royals are outfitted in these tacky getups for a good cause. Phew! In fact, the whole royal family gave permission to have their wax figures decked out in festive holiday sweaters as a part of Save The Children U.K.’s Christmas Jumper Day fundraiser on December 16th (the royals will be dressed up through the month of December, though).

“We are delighted to support Save The Children by having our royal wax figures join in with the Christmas Jumper Day campaign in a seriously stylish way,” said Edward Fuller, general manager of Madame Tussauds London, in an interview with People.

Added Helena Wiltshire, head of PR at Save the Children, “Who knows, maybe the queen will feel inspired to do her annual speech in a more laid-back get-up this year?”
